North Daviess was the 7-0 winner over Evansville Christian when they last played one another back in April of 2024, but their luck changed this time around. The Cougars fell just short of the Eagles by a score of 2-1 on Thursday. The Cougars have now taken an 'L' in back-to-back games.
North Daviess' defeat dropped their record down to 12-11-1. As for Evansville Christian, with the victory, they broke their three-game losing streak and moved their record to 7-13.
Looking ahead, North Daviess will square off against Washington at 10:30 a.m. on Monday. The Cougars are facing the Hatchets at the right time seeing as the Hatchets are stuck on a three-game losing streak. As for Evansville Christian, they will welcome Mt. Vernon at 5:30 p.m. on Monday.
